What is a shark researcher?
A shark researcher is a scientist who studies the behavior, ecology, physiology, and conservation of sharks. They may conduct field research to observe sharks in their natural habitat, or they may work in a laboratory setting to study shark anatomy, genetics, and physiology. Shark researchers also play a crucial role in shark conservation efforts by studying the impact of human activities on shark populations and advocating for policies to protect these important apex predators.

What is a theological Christian researcher?
A theological Christian researcher is a scholar who conducts in-depth study and analysis of Christian theology, doctrine, and biblical texts. They seek to understand and interpret the teachings of Christianity within the context of historical, cultural, and philosophical perspectives. Their research often involves exploring the implications of Christian beliefs for contemporary issues and engaging in dialogue with other religious traditions. Theological Christian researchers may also contribute to the development of Christian thought and practice through their scholarly work.

How can one become a shark researcher?
To become a shark researcher, one typically needs a strong educational background in marine biology, zoology, or a related field. Pursuing a bachelor's degree in one of these areas is a good starting point, followed by a master's or doctoral degree for more specialized research opportunities. Gaining hands-on experience through internships, volunteering, or working in a research lab focused on sharks can also be beneficial. Networking with other researchers in the field and staying up-to-date on current research and trends in shark biology is important for building a successful career as a shark researcher.

How does one become a disaster researcher?
To become a disaster researcher, one typically needs a background in a related field such as emergency management, public health, sociology, or environmental science. Many disaster researchers have advanced degrees such as a master's or Ph.D. in a relevant discipline. It is also important to gain experience through internships, research assistant positions, or working in the field of disaster response and recovery. Networking with other researchers and professionals in the field can also be beneficial for finding opportunities in disaster research.

How can one become a dream researcher?
To become a dream researcher, one typically needs to obtain a graduate degree in psychology, neuroscience, or a related field. It is important to gain research experience through internships, assistantships, or independent studies during undergraduate and graduate studies. Building a strong foundation in statistics and research methodology is also crucial. Additionally, networking with established dream researchers and staying updated on the latest research in the field can be beneficial for aspiring dream researchers.
